MacVoices #23188: MacVoices Live! - Sonoma Drops Mail Plugin Support; Silo's Success (1)

Published: July 7, 2023, 1:53 a.m.

b'

This MacVoices Live! session starts off with a discussion of the impact of Apple\'s API restrictions on third-party applications, particularly in relation to mail plug-ins in Sonoma. Chuck Joiner,\\xa0Jim Rea,\\xa0David Ginsburg,\\xa0Ben Roethig,\\xa0Brian Flanigan-Arthurs and\\xa0Web Bixby\\xa0explore the importance of having a backup plan and the challenges faced by developers when APIs lack functionality. We also cover alternative options for Gmail users and workarounds for using Apple Mail with Outlook. Other topics include MSG file compatibility on Mac, the popularity of shows like "Silo" and "Foundation," and the possibility of a season four of "Ted Lasso.\\u201d (Part 1)\\xa0
